Lemongrass is a grassy plant used in cooking, tropical, and medicine. Lemon grass oil is extracted from the leaves of the lemongrass plant. Lemongrass essential oil has a potent citrus scent. It could often be found in soaps and other personal care products.
Lemongrass oil is also being used by healthcare providers to treat high blood pressure and digestive problems. It has so many other potential benefits as well.
Lemongrass essential oil is a famous tool in aromatherapy helps to relieve anxiety, stress, and depression. These are the ways you can use lemongrass essential oils to improve your health.
